Kullanıcı Kılavuzu

Get Role Groups With Relations

28/1/26
Get Role Groups With Relations

Kuika’nın Get Role Groups With Relations aksiyonu, sistemde tanımlı olan rol gruplarını, bu rol gruplarına bağlı roller ve ilişkili rol gruplarıyla birlikte listelemek için kullanılır. Bu aksiyon, rol grubu–rol ilişkilerini tek seferde getirerek yetkilendirme yapısının bütünsel olarak görüntülenmesini sağlar.

Get Role Groups With Relations, özellikle karmaşık yetkilendirme senaryolarında rol gruplarının içerdiği rollerin ve hiyerarşik ilişkilerin birlikte gösterilmesi gereken yönetim ekranlarında tercih edilir.

Teknik Özellikler

  • İlişkili Rol Grupları Listeleme (Authorization Paneli): Rol gruplarını, bağlı roller ve rol grubu ilişkileriyle birlikte döner. Böylece ek bir aksiyon çağrısına ihtiyaç duymadan tüm yetkilendirme yapısı görüntülenebilir.
  • Authorization Uyumu: Getirilen rol grubu ve ilişki verileri, Authorization altyapısıyla tam uyumludur ve yetki kontrolü, görüntüleme veya düzenleme işlemlerinde kullanılabilir.
  • Web & Mobil Destek: Aksiyon hem web hem de mobil platformlarda desteklenir.

Get Role Groups With Relations Aksiyonu Uygulama Adımları

1. UI Design’da Aksiyonu Tanımlama

  • Kuika platformunda projenizi açın.
  • UI Design modülüne geçin ve ilgili ekranı seçin.
  • Rol gruplarını ilişkileriyle birlikte göstermek için bir buton, tablo veya sayfa açılış tetikleyicisi oluşturun (örneğin “Rol Gruplarını İlişkileriyle Gör”).
  • İlgili elementi seçin ve + ADD ACTION menüsünden, kullanılacak tetikleyici olaya göre Authorization → Get Role Groups With Relations aksiyonunu ekleyin.

2. Aksiyon Parametreleri

Get Role Groups With Relations aksiyonu zorunlu parametre içermez. Aksiyon çalıştığında sistemde tanımlı tüm rol grupları, ilişkili roller ve rol grubu bağlantılarıyla birlikte listelenir.

3. Opsiyonel Ayarlar

Enable Audit Logs (Boolean – opsiyonel): Aktif edildiğinde, rol gruplarının ilişkileriyle birlikte listelenmesi işlemi audit log kayıtlarına eklenir. Bu sayede hangi kullanıcının, ne zaman ve hangi aksiyon aracılığıyla yetkilendirme yapısını görüntülediği izlenebilir. Yetki yönetimi ve güvenlik takibi gereken uygulamalarda aktif edilmesi önerilir.

Kullanım Senaryosu: Rol Gruplarını İlişkileriyle Listeleme

Bir yönetim panelinde, sistemdeki rol gruplarının hiyerarşik yapısını göstermek amacıyla Get Role Groups With Relations aksiyonu kullanılır. Aksiyon tetiklendiğinde:

  • Rol grubu adları
  • Rol gruplarına bağlı roller
  • Alt / üst rol grubu ilişkileri

tek bir veri seti halinde getirilir ve tabloda veya ağaç (tree) yapısında görüntülenebilir. Bu yapı, yetki mimarisini hızlıca analiz etmeyi ve düzenlemeyi kolaylaştırır.

Teknik Riskler

  • Yetkisiz Erişim: Bu aksiyonun yalnızca yetkilendirme yönetimi yetkisi olan kullanıcılar tarafından çalıştırılması sağlanmalıdır.
  • Audit Takibi: Kurumsal ve regülasyon gerektiren uygulamalarda Enable Audit Logs seçeneğinin aktif edilmesi önerilir.
  • Veri Sunumu: İlişkili veri yapısı karmaşık olabileceğinden, uygun UI bileşenleri (tree, accordion, expandable table vb.) ile gösterilmesi tavsiye edilir.
No items found.

İlişkili diğer içerikler

No items found.

Sözlük

No items found.

Alt Başlıklar